Sampling is the first step in understanding soil fertility and, from there, knowing how much the soil will provide to the plant and when you should add more through fertilization. There are some critical points in the sampling process that, if neglected, can result in poor representation of the total area and, consequently, lead you to incorrectly recommend crop fertilization and soil correction. Thus, inadequate sampling can lead to over-liming and wasting a lot of money on fertilizers!!!! What a mess, huh!! Want to understand this topic better? Keep reading!
